Driving in Kuwait: One of the essential aspects of parenting in Kuwait is getting around, and for many families, this means driving. The Kuwaiti roads can be a busy and daunting place, especially for parents juggling multiple tasks or driving with young children. To ensure a safe and smooth ride, consider investing in quality car seats that meet safety standards. Additionally, familiarize yourself with Kuwaiti traffic rules and regulations to navigate the roads confidently. Balancing Tradition and Modernity: As parents in the Kuwaiti Urdu community, striking a balance between preserving cultural traditions and embracing modern values can be a delicate dance. Encourage your children to embrace their cultural heritage while also exposing them to diverse perspectives and experiences. Engage in open and honest conversations with your children about their identity and help them navigate the complexities of growing up in a multicultural society.
